Gold Leaching ( carbon in leach) process is widely used in the newly built gold leaching plants in recent years, and a lot of plants are changing into CIL as well. Gold Leaching CIL process is suitable for the treatment of oxidized gold ore with low sulfur content and mud content. It is unsuitable for the gold ore with high-grade silver.

The gold cyanide complex is then extracted from the pulp or slurry by adsorption onto activated carbon. CIL stands for carbon-in-leach. This is a gold extraction process called cyanidation where carbon is added to the leach tanks (or reaction vessel) so that leaching and adsorption take place in the same tanks.

Carbon in Pulp Plant. Sslurry at a rate of approximately 3.785 cu. m. per minute (1,000 GPM) is placed in contact with activated carbon. A simplified flow-sheet of the CIP Plant is shown in Figure 2. For years it has been known of the affinity of activated carbon to adsorb preferentially the gold and silver in cyanide complex form.

The carbon-in-pulp or carbon-in-leach (CIP and CIL) processes have been the main commercial processes on almost every gold plant built since 1980 (Fleming, 1992; Van Deventer, 1984) with a stable interest in the process still existing (Vorob''ev-Desyatovskii et al., 2012).
The gold cyanide complex is then extracted from the pulp or slurry by adsorption onto activated carbon. CIL stands for carbon-in-leach. This is a gold extraction process called cyanidation where carbon is added to the leach tanks (or reaction vessel) so that leaching and adsorption take place in the same tanks.

The carbon has a very high affinity for the aurocyanide complex and adsorbs the gold out of solution resulting in very high loadings on the carbon (typically 1000-4000 g/t). At the end of the leach the loaded carbon is removed from the slurry and the adsorbed gold is stripped out at high temperature and pressure with sodium hydroxide and cyanide solutions to form a high value electrolyte solution.
Cip Plant Saimm Adsorption Cyanide. The process design of gold leaching and carbon in pulp circuits. by W. Stange* Introduction Assuming that a gold ore has been effectively ground to ensure maximum economic liberation of gold, the circuits that will have the most effect on the successful operation of a gold plant will be that of the leaching and carbon in pulp circuit (CIP).
